Lettuce Wraps Recipe

Ingredients:

1 1/2 lbs. chicken
1/4 c. soy sauce
3 Tbsp. sugar
1/4 tsp. pepper
2 Tbsp. oil
3 green onions
2 cloves garlic
Optional: water chestnuts and 1/2 c. diced carrots
1 head of iceberg or romaine lettuce
Cooked rice

Directions:

Cook chicken until no longer pink. Dice. Prepare remaining ingredients in a bowl; mix well. Add to chicken and simmer for 5 to 10 minutes over medium heat (or until carrots are tender). To make the lettuce wraps, carefully wash and remove full leaves from a head of iceberg lettuce. Spoon some rice and chicken mixture in the leaf. Wrap the leaf (like a burrito) Use soy sauce to taste! Enjoy!
